Question 300D CMOS specification needed.

Would someone point me in the direction of a specifications sheet for the cmos sensor of the Canon 300D.

I can find lots of blah blah, but very little meat. Yes I know how big it is and how many pixel, effective or otherwise. What I want to know is who made it, ie what brand, what is it's effective dynamic range ( not just it's number of bits - yes 12 bit), well depth, noise characteristics, QE, yadda yadda.

All the really useful information that seems to be a state secret somewhere.
